使用Objective C写入XML

时间:2015-04-20 06:57:15

标签: objective-c xml

我有2个NSMutableArray' s。一个是存储字符串,另一个是存储一组NSMutableArray。所以布局看起来像这样:

NSMutableArrayParent {
    NSMutableArrayChild {
        someString
    }
    NSMutableArrayChild {
        someString
    }
    NSMutableArrayChild {
        someString
    }
}

我希望将此数据写入XML文件。

我看过this question,但没有具体告诉我如何编写XML文件(事实上这里没有任何问题)。

我希望XML文件看起来像这样:

<parent name="someParentName">
      <child name="someChildName">  
             <data>someString</data>
      </child>        
</parent>

现在,就像链接问题中的答案一样,我可以附加到NSMutableString并获取类似<data>someString</data>的行,但是如何获得结束child和结束parent标记?

我经历了this tutorial,但它使用的是GDataXML而不是Objective C的原生内容。

另外,我怎样才能将此XML实际写入磁盘?

我使用Objective C和mac。

谢谢!

0 个答案:

没有答案